-
21.
公开(公告)号:US20190265704A1
公开(公告)日:2019-08-29
申请号:US16290380
申请日:2019-03-01
Applicant: CLEARPATH ROBOTICS INC.
Inventor: Ryan Christopher Gariepy , Alex Bencz , Andrew Clifford Blakey , Shahab Kaynama , James Servos
Abstract: Systems, methods and apparatus are provided for handling operational constraints for unmanned vehicles. The system includes: a plurality of mobile unmanned vehicles for deployment in an environment; a computing device connected to the plurality of unmanned vehicles via a network, the computing device storing, in a memory, a plurality of operational constraints; each operational constraint including (i) a type identifier, (ii) an indication of a region of the environment, and (iii) a property defining a constraint on the operation of the unmanned vehicles within the region. The computing device is configured to: receive a request from one of the mobile unmanned vehicles, the request identifying an operational constraint; responsive to receiving the request, retrieve an operational constraint from the memory based on the request; and send the retrieved operational constraint to the one of the mobile unmanned vehicles.
-
22.
公开(公告)号:US10241515B2
公开(公告)日:2019-03-26
申请号:US15167002
申请日:2016-05-27
Applicant: CLEARPATH ROBOTICS, INC.
Inventor: Ryan Christopher Gariepy , Alex Bencz , Andrew Clifford Blakey , Shahab Kaynama , James Servos
Abstract: Systems, methods and apparatus are provided for handling operational constraints for unmanned vehicles. The system includes: a plurality of mobile unmanned vehicles for deployment in an environment; a computing device connected to the plurality of unmanned vehicles via a network, the computing device storing, in a memory, a plurality of operational constraints; each operational constraint including (i) a type identifier, (ii) an indication of a region of the environment, and (iii) a property defining a constraint on the operation of the unmanned vehicles within the region. The computing device is configured to: receive a request from one of the mobile unmanned vehicles, the request identifying an operational constraint; responsive to receiving the request, retrieve an operational constraint from the memory based on the request; and send the retrieved operational constraint to the one of the mobile unmanned vehicles.
-
公开(公告)号:US10191494B2
公开(公告)日:2019-01-29
申请号:US15827391
申请日:2017-11-30
Applicant: Clearpath Robotics Inc.
Inventor: Ryan Christopher Gariepy , Yan Ma , Alex Bencz
Abstract: A system, method and apparatus for implementation of variable references frames in unmanned vehicles is provided, which includes an unmanned vehicle comprising: a chassis; a propulsion system configured to move the chassis; sensor(s) configured to sense features around the chassis; a memory storing a global reference frame associated with an environment within which the chassis is to move; a communication interface; and a processor configured to: receive, using the interface, a command to move to a given coordinate in the global reference frame; control the propulsion system to move the chassis to the given coordinate; when the chassis is at the given coordinate, determine, using the sensor(s), that a given feature is detected; and, when so: automatically cease controlling the propulsion system according to the global reference frame; automatically move the chassis according to a local reference frame defined with reference to a point associated with the given feature.
-
公开(公告)号:US09963155B2
公开(公告)日:2018-05-08
申请号:US15164280
申请日:2016-05-25
Applicant: CLEARPATH ROBOTICS, INC.
Inventor: Ryan Christopher Gariepy , Alex Bencz , Yan Ma , Michael Irvine , Shahab Kaynama , James Servos , Peiyi Chen
CPC classification number: B61L3/006 , B61L3/008 , B61L15/0072 , G05D1/0066 , G05D1/0088 , G05D1/0238 , G05D2201/0212
Abstract: A system for path control for a mobile unmanned vehicle in an environment is provided. The system includes: a sensor connected to the mobile unmanned vehicle; the mobile unmanned vehicle configured to initiate a first fail-safe routine responsive to detection of an object in a first sensor region adjacent to the sensor; and a processor connected to the mobile unmanned vehicle. The processor is configured to: generate a current path based on a map of the environment; based on the current path, issue velocity commands to cause the mobile unmanned vehicle to execute the current path; responsive to detection of an obstacle in a second sensor region, initiate a second fail-safe routine in the mobile unmanned vehicle to avoid entry of the obstacle into the first sensor region and initiation of the first fail-safe routine.
-
公开(公告)号:US09606544B2
公开(公告)日:2017-03-28
申请号:US14927930
申请日:2015-10-30
Applicant: CLEARPATH ROBOTICS, INC.
Inventor: Ryan Christopher Gariepy , Alex Bencz
CPC classification number: G05D1/0297 , G05D2201/0216
Abstract: A system for controlling a fleet of unmanned vehicles includes a plurality of unmanned vehicles connected to a computing device. The computing device stores a dynamic attribute and a static attribute respective to each of the plurality of unmanned vehicles. The computing device is configured to: receive a task request including (i) an item identifier of an item, (ii) an action type defining an action to be performed respective to the item, and (iii) a location identifier of a location at which to perform the action; responsive to receiving the request, retrieve the stored dynamic attributes and static attributes; based on a comparison of the task request with the dynamic attributes and the static attributes, select one of the plurality of unmanned vehicles; and transmit, via the network, a command to the selected unmanned vehicle to perform the action respective to the item at the location.
-
-
-
-